1852 (Apr. 30) Liverpool, England to New York, N.Y., folded letter that did not enter the British postal system, carried by Great Britain from Liverpool May 1 to New York arriving May 14, New York "2nd Delivery" black straightline handstamp and matching circled "6" rating for ship letter fee, Very Fine, This Is the Only Recorded Cover Carried By Great Britain after her 1846 Grounding. A scarce non-contract steamship sailing. Estimate $300 - 400. The New York second delivery marking was used to show the letter was received after others were turned in by the ship. The "Great Britain" made only three round voyages across the Atlantic after grounding, one in 1852, one in 1858, and one in 1859. $0 (Image)
